Pedidos
Buscar pedidos não integrados

Buscar pedidos não integrados

GEThttps://erp.hub.it4360.com/api/v1/orders

Este endpoint permite buscar pedidos não integrados. Isso é útil quando você deseja buscar pedidos que ainda não integraram nos seus sistemas.

Rate limit

Quantidade de RequisiçõesTempo em Segundos
12060

Parâmetros

ParâmetroTipoLocalizaçãoDescriçãoObrigatório
IdDataSourceCompanyBranchstringHeaderIdentificador da Company Branch.Sim
AuthorizationstringHeaderToken de autenticação.Sim
OffsetintQueryNúmero de registros a serem ignorados no início da lista de resultados.Sim
LimitintQueryNúmero máximo de registros a serem retornados na resposta.Não
InitialDateDateTimeQueryData de início do intervalo de consulta.Não
FinalDateDateTimeQueryData de término do intervalo de consulta.Não

Exemplos de Requisição

curl --location 'https://erp.hub.it4360.com/api/v1/orders?Offset=10&Limit=50&InitialDate=2023-10-10T16%3A28%3A00Z&FinalDate=2023-10-10T16%3A32%3A00Z' \
	--header 'IdDataSourceCompanyBranch: BR57BCF9-D043-4480-B9EF-A7C2641F0B82' \
	--header 'Accept: text/plain' \
	--header 'Authorization: Bearer token-de-autorizacao' \

Respostas

  • 200 Success - Sucesso. Uma lista de pedido sera exibida.

    Corpo da Resposta (Exemplo):

    "orders": [
    {
    "id": "string",
    "orderNumber": "string",
    "idOrderSiteExhibition": "string",
    "totalGrossValue": 0,
    "totalDiscount": 0,
    "totalFreight": 0,
    "totalNetValue": 0,
    "totalIncrease": 0,
    "note": "string",
    "date": "2025-08-27T10:55:19.623Z",
    "orderStatus": {
    "status": 6,
    "statusDescription": "Invoiced"
    },
    "customer": {
    "cpf": "string",
    "firstName": "string",
    "lastName": "string",
    "email": "string",
    "phone": "string",
    "neighborhood": "string",
    "street": "string",
    "complement": "string",
    "number": "string",
    "city": "string",
    "state": "string",
    "postalCode": "string"
    },
    "items": [
    {
      "description": "string",
      "refSku": "string",
      "ean": "string",
      "grossValue": 0,
      "netValue": 0,
      "freight": 0,
      "discount": 0,
      "increase": 0,
      "shippingAddress": {
        "receiverName": "string",
        "street": "string",
        "number": "string",
        "neighborhood": "string",
        "complement": "string",
        "city": "string",
        "state": "string",
        "postalCode": "string"
      },
      "shippingMethod": {
        "name": "string",
        "code": "string",
        "erpShippingName": "string",
        "erpShippingCode": "string",
        "carrier": {
          "name": "string",
          "code": "string",
          "erpCarrierName": "string",
          "erpCarrierCode": "string"
        }
      }
    }
    ],
    "payments": [
    {
      "paidValue": 0,
      "installment": 0,
      "nsu": "string",
      "idTransaction": "string",
      "authId": "string",
      "approval": "string",
      "giftCardCod": "string",
      "paymentDate": "2025-08-27T10:55:19.623Z",
      "approvalDate": "2025-08-27T10:55:19.623Z",
      "paymentMethod": {
        "description": "string",
        "code": "string",
        "erpCode": "string"
      },
      "flag": {
        "description": "string",
        "code": "string",
        "erpCode": "string"
      }
    }
    ],
    "customProperties": [
    {
      "key": "string",
      "value": "string"
    }
    ]
    }
     }
     ]}
  • 400 Bad Request - Não foi possível atender à requisição. Valide os dados informados.

    Corpo da Resposta (Exemplo):

    "Mensagem de erro detalhada."